Top 5 Slime Games on iOS in Oman for Q3 2021
An overview of the performance of the top 5 slime games on iOS in Oman for the third quarter of 2021,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2021, the top 5 slime games on iOS in Oman showcased interesting tr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a detailed look at their performance based on Sensor Tower data.
Goo: Slime simulator, ASMR from Exomind LTD saw a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 741 in the week of September 6. Weekly revenue showed a modest peak of $7 in mid-August, while active users surged to 733 in mid-September before declining to 414 by the end of the month.
Super Slime Simulator, published by Dramaton LTD, had steady weekly downloads with a high of 97 in early July. Weekly revenue remained consistent at $1 for most of the quarter. Active users fluctuated, starting at 346 and ending at 221 by the end of September.
Fluid Simulation by Pavel Dobryakov experienced varied weekly downloads, with a peak of 60 in late August. Weekly revenue showed a high of $30 in early July but dropped to $0 by mid-September. Active users saw a peak of 128 in late August before decreasing to 53 by the end of the quarter.
Virtual Slime, from Cider Software LLC, had a peak in weekly downloads at 41 in late June, while revenue peaked at $5 in late July. Active users started at 151 in late June, dropping to 64 by the end of September.
Makeup Slime Game! Relaxation, published by Shanze Shafique, showed modest weekly downloads with a peak of 14 in late July. Active users peaked at 45 in late July before dropping to 10 by mid-August.
